McLaren Automotive says an electric P1 has been added to its ever-expanding range, but is on offer to a limited group of potential customers only: those under the age of six.
Yes, the British automaker has whipped the covers off a diminutive McLaren P1, resplendent in Volcano Yellow and featuring a central driving position, just like the iconic McLaren F1.
Interestingly, this little P1 features an open roof, but still retains McLaren’s signature dihedral doors.
“Like every McLaren, its acceleration is startling. The zero to maximum speed dash takes just two seconds,” the brand cheekily states in its press release. That top speed, though, is less than 5 km/h.
The vehicle features an audio system pre-programmed with a number of popular nursery rhymes, while the three-speed transmission also handily boasts a reverse gear.
The automaker says the new vehicle will be available from selected McLaren retailers around the world from the end of October, priced at £375 (about R6 600)…
